      As much as I think Taxi Driver and Rocky are great films I’m going to choose Assault on Precinct 13. It one of my favourite John Carpenter films. It’s a low budget affair but it doesn’t seem to harm the film at all. Great score, builds tension well and features a strong female lead which was unusual at the time.

          Some quality films this year.

          Carrie I came to very late and only saw it for the first time recently. Amazing, bold adaptation. Assault On Precinct 13 is a given, love John Carpenter. Rocky, iconic film, tons of heart. Logan's Run is an interesting one. I saw it as a kid and the imagery (carousel) stayed in my head for tears.

          But Taxi Driver takes my vote as an ultimate fave. Probably in my all time top five ... okay, maybe top ten It's like a super-group of a film, all in perfect harmony. Wonderful snapshot of an edgier New York too. You can smell the grimy hot summer nights.
